搜索到与相关的文章
Python

浅谈Python单向链表的实现

链表由一系列不必在内存中相连的结构构成,这些对象按线性顺序排序。每个结构含有表元素和指向后继元素的指针。最后一个单元的指针指向NULL。为了方便链表的删除与插入操作,可以为链表添加一个表头。删除操作可以通过修改一个指针来实现。插入操作需要执行两次指针调整。1.单向链表的实现1.1Node实现每个Node分为两部分。一部分含有链表的元素,可以称为数据域;另一部分为一指针,指向下一个Node。classNode():__slots__=['_item','_n

系统 2019-09-27 17:37:36 2226

编程技术

搜索引擎体系结构设计

最近在做一个关于搜索引擎方面的项目,于是乎研究了一点关于搜索引擎方面的东西。我们的目标是做一个轻量级的搜索引擎,相对真正的商业搜索引擎来说还是较为简单的。对于搜索引擎这样的项目来说,我觉得重点在于质量要求,对于功能要求可能会弱一点。高并发,高存储量和快速查询是一个搜索引擎的命脉,而在功能上重点要注意的是几个算法的实现。以前做的项目大多数只是注重功能的实现,对于性能的要求很低,而这次的项目则要求我们对这方面有所注重,也是一次很好的学习过程。从该项目的需求出发

系统 2019-08-29 23:20:18 2226

编程技术

你是一个能成功推动变革的人吗?

每当这时,我就想呼吁,“人”不是一个“巨大的黑箱”,“人”作为一种重要的、有时甚至是最重要的管理要素,是可观察、可分析、可量化、可转化的。这个“黑箱”不打开,面对这个“黑箱”的却步不打破,企业里的企业管理部/信息部/流程管理专员,作为流程管理的推进者就永远走不远。本文关键字变革每次和企业里的一些经理谈到“流程管理是场变革,涉及到人……”,经理人给出的下文往往是“变革关键是人”、“一旦涉及到人就难办”,前一句话说的是“人”的重要,后一句话说的是改革推进者面对

系统 2019-08-29 22:39:14 2226

编程技术

Yahoo! Web hosting到底怎么样

GetOnlineWebHostingEasilycreateaprofessionalwebsiteEnjoysecure,reliableserviceLearnmoreDomainsGetanexclusivewebaddressLearnmoreSellOnlineMerchantSolutionsQuicklyandeasilycreateanecommercesiteSellonlinearound-the-clockGet24-hourpho

系统 2019-08-29 22:16:34 2226

编程技术

如何用 Eclipse 调试 Perl 应用程序

如何用Eclipse调试Perl应用程序8/14/201011:30:36PM开始之前本教程将介绍Eclipse的EPIC插件提供的调试功能,该插件提供了功能丰富的调试环境——可为EPICPerl开发环境所用且与此开发环境相集成。本教程假设读者了解Eclipse环境,并且有使用Perl的经验。关于本教程EPIC结合了两种有助于Perl应用程序测试流程的系统:RegExp和调试器。RegExp是一个测试Perl正则表达式的接口。正则表达式是许多Perl应用程

系统 2019-08-12 09:30:13 2226

编程技术

Web开发人员速查卡

Web开发人员速查卡时间:2011-06-3010:04来源:coolshell.cn作者:酷壳无论你是多牛的程序员,你都无法记住所有的东西。而很多时候,查找某些知识又比较费事。所以,网上有很多CheatSheets,翻译成小抄也好,速查卡也好,总之就是帮你节省时间的。之前给大家介绍过Web设计的速查卡、25个jQuery的编程小抄,还有程序员小抄无论你是多牛的程序员,你都无法记住所有的东西。而很多时候,查找某些知识又比较费事。所以,网上有很多CheatS

系统 2019-08-12 09:29:59 2226

各行各业

VC操纵Word

我们操纵Word需要通过类型库中的MFC类。而这些类,应该都是基于一个叫COleDispatchDriver的类。至少我所了解到的都是这样。COleDispatchDriver没有基类。COleDispatchDriver类实现OLE自动化中的客户方。OLE调度接口为访问一个对象的方法和属性提供了途径。COleDispatchDriver的成员函数连接,分离,创建和释放一个IDispatch类型的调度连接。其它的成员函数使用变量参数列表来简化调用IDisp

系统 2019-08-12 09:27:14 2226

数据库相关

输出字符串Count and Say

最近研究输出字符串,稍微总结一下,以后继续补充:标题如下:Thecount-and-saysequenceisthesequenceofintegersbeginningasfollows:1,11,21,1211,111221,...1isreadoffas"one1"or11.11isreadoffas"two1s"or21.21isreadoffas"one2,thenone1"or1211.Givenanintegern,generatethent

系统 2019-08-12 01:54:50 2226

数据库相关

git常用命令收集-tag

二、tag1、列出所有标签gittag2、过滤某些标签Git使用的标签有两种类型:轻量级的(lightweight)和含附注的(annotated)。轻量级标签就像是个不会变化的分支,实际上它就是个指向特定提交对象的引用。而含附注标签,实际上是存储在仓库中的一个独立对象,它有自身的校验和信息,包含着标签的名字,电子邮件地址和日期,以及标签说明,标签本身也允许使用GNUPrivacyGuard(GPG)来签署或验证。一般我们都建议使用含附注型的标签,以便保留

系统 2019-08-12 01:54:17 2226